‘Afternoon Blend’ Highlights New Programs on MSPR

Morehead State Public Radio (WMKY, 90.3FM) has announced new weekday afternoon and overnight programs to include smooth jazz and adult hits, traditional jazz classics, and the New York Philharmonic. The new weekday and overnight program schedule will begin the week of June 16.

Afternoon Blend

Afternoon Blend (Tuesday – Friday, noon to 3:00 p.m.) is a production of WMKY with smooth jazz and adult hits for an upbeat mix of jazz instrumentals, familiar hits, and contemporary sounds from today’s singers, songwriters, and musicians.

Overnight Jazz

The Jazz Network from WFMT (weekdays, midnight to 5:00 a.m.) offers the finest in traditional jazz and jazz vocalists performing classics from the Great American Songbook. Hosts include vocalist Dee Alexander, jazz experts John Hill and Dave Schwan, and pianist/vocalist Jana Lee Ross.

Morning Classics with Greg Jenkins

Greg Jenkins (Monday – Thursday, 9:00 a.m. to noon) continues WMKY’s tradition of offering the best in popular classical music. Special features include 90 Second Naturalist, A Moment of Science, Morehead State Today, The Reader’s Notebook, and Word of The Day.

New York Philharmonic

The New York Philharmonic from WFMT (Monday, 1:00 p.m. to 3:00 p.m.) presents recent performances plus selections from archives and commercial recordings. Since their first live national radio broadcast over the CBS network on October 5, 1930, the New York Philharmonic has enjoyed an almost continuous presence on national radio.

Modern Notebook

Composer and musician Tyler Kline journeys into new territory with music from contemporary classical artists and living composers on Modern Notebook (Friday, 9:00 a.m. to 10:00 a.m.). The program showcases a variety of music that engages and inspires, along with stories behind the music for a journey into contemporary classical music.

WFMT Orchestra Series

The WFMT Orchestra Series (Friday, 10:00 a.m. to noon) spotlights orchestras from across the country and around the world. The Los Angeles Philharmonic, Milwaukee Symphony Orchestra, San Francisco Symphony, and orchestras from Europe, United Kingdom, and around the world are regularly featured.

WMKY serves more than twenty counties throughout eastern Kentucky from the campus of Morehead State University. Listeners can listen to WMKY at 90.3FM, online (www.wmky.org), phone apps, or smart speakers (“Play WMKY”).
